In March, my friend, JiSung, and I started filming for the 2nd Annual UCC Video Competition. The contest is run jointly between Google and KoreaBrand.net and is trying to increase global awareness about Korea and its culture. This year's contest was "My Korean Recipe."

We have been keeping our meetings/filming a secret for the most part, however we are finally done now and ready to reveal our video! It is making Teokbokki which is a favourite Korean snack made basically from rice-cakes and hot-red pepper paste. We decided that we wanted to do something fun and unique instead of a typical 'cooking show' and so we made it a stop-motion video, which turns out to be not as unique as we hoped as there were about 4 or 5 others who made a similar movie. However, I think ours has good taste (no pun intended) and is very entertaining.
